    About Marathon Health

    Marathon Health () is one of the nation's leading providers of employer-based health services. We serve businesses throughout the United States, providing a different kind of healthcare program that focuses on total population health management and health risk reduction.

    Clinic support staff are responsible for supporting both the front and back office, including greeting and rooming patients, taking vitals, drawing blood, administering vaccines, and providing additional clinical support wherever needed. Maintaining a collaborative relationship with the center's staff is a key ingredient to success in this position.

    • Minimum of 1 year of clinical experience as a licensed MA, LPN, or RN, preferably within a primary care setting
    • Phlebotomy/venipuncture experience required
    • Attention to detail, ability to communicate effectively with patients and strong computer skills required
